Airwars assessment

Up to five civilians died and several more were injured in an alleged Russian or Assad regime airstrike on the third station near al Sukhna, local sources reported.

According to the Step News Agency, “Russian warplanes launched several air raids targeting the third station near al Sukhna in eastern Homs which led to a number of civilian injuries”.

The Smart News Agency reported: “Five people were killed and a number of others wounded on Wednesday [March 15th], in an aerial bombardment likely to have been carried out by Russia and the regime targeting at Sokhna town (70 km east of Palmyra), in the countryside of Homs east”.

 

The local time of the incident is unknown.
